In the last few weeks, I have had difficulty opening Office software.
Whenever i click on an application, windows installer opens up, and then
requests that i insert the disc to add the software. Entering the CD never
solves the problem. It can't find what it needs. Eventually, I can get word
or powerpoint to open up, but it takes a few minutes each time.

Should I reinstall the whole disc and start from the begining

Windows XP Home; 1.79 Ghz and 1 gb ram; have had office installed since 2003
